    ANOTHER WIRE QUESTION

    Let’s say I have 6awg wire from battery to fuse block and the block is 4’ from the unit. Is it best to run the power wire straight to the fuse block or run a 10awg and shorten the power wire to let’s say 1’?

    if more power wire size was needed it would be a bigger gauge to the end of the wire so using some or all of it should not matter. the smallest gauge wire dictates the most amount of current it can carry whether 1" or 4' long
